Lots of highlights today so it's difficult to know where to start!

The Long-billed Dowitcher was on the Mere for most of the day, and still present when the reserve closed. Also on the Mere, a single Knot, and 40+ Avocets, along with the usual Ruff, Black-tailed Godwits and Oystercatchers.

A great raptor day as well, with a male Hen Harrier, Merlin, Peregrine and Barn Owl.

From the Janet Kear hide, 6 Siskins, with a Woodcock nearby.

Other noteworthy birds included at least 3 Mediterranean Gulls and 2 Great White Egrets.
